> FYI, this bug can be found by patched AddressSanitizer:

> diff --git a/lib/asan/asan_interceptors.cc b/lib/asan/asan_interceptors.cc
> index faac15b..d41a665 100644
> --- a/lib/asan/asan_interceptors.cc
> +++ b/lib/asan/asan_interceptors.cc
> @@ -214,6 +214,17 @@ DECLARE_REAL_AND_INTERCEPTOR(void, free, void *)
> } while (false)
> #include "sanitizer_common/sanitizer_common_syscalls.inc"
>
> +
> +INTERCEPTOR(SSIZE_T, recvfrom, int fd, void *buf, SIZE_T len, int flags,
> + void *srcaddr, int *addrlen) {
> + ENSURE_ASAN_INITED();
> + SIZE_T srcaddr_sz;
> + if (srcaddr) srcaddr_sz = *addrlen;
> + ASAN_READ_RANGE(nullptr, buf, len);
> + SSIZE_T res = REAL(recvfrom)(fd, buf, len, flags, srcaddr, addrlen);
> + return res;
> +}
> +
> struct ThreadStartParam {
> atomic_uintptr_t t;
> atomic_uintptr_t is_registered;
> @@ -759,6 +770,8 @@ void InitializeAsanInterceptors() {
> ASAN_INTERCEPT_FUNC(memcpy);
> }
>
> + INTERCEPT_FUNCTION(recvfrom);
> +
> // Intercept str* functions.
> ASAN_INTERCEPT_FUNC(strcat); // NOLINT
> ASAN_INTERCEPT_FUNC(strchr);
>
>
>
> Kostya, perhaps it makes sense to add recvfrom interceptor to ASan? MSan
> has it.
